// Relevance tuning constants for the Quillsearch plugin API.
// Plugin authors: these weights balance title matches against body
// matches and were tuned on the Harlow corpus. Do not override them
// per-plugin; use the boost hooks instead. Changes here require a
// full re-run of the relevance benchmark. The benchmark run these
// values were validated against is identified by the token below.

pipeline stamp: htk31_f769b577b3028a4e9958e5bb8d1259a

## Changelog — Orderline 4.2.1

We rotated the plugin signing key as part of this release. Orders in the `orders` table are now soft-deleted: a `deleted_at` timestamp replaces hard row removal, so plugin queries must filter on it explicitly. Plugins compiled against 4.1 will continue to work, but re-signing is required before the next deploy window. Verify your bundles against the new key below.

signing key of bagap-yawep = bky13_TbfT6ZMUoGJo2

## Releases

Load tests run against the Cartline checkout flow before every release. Use the peakday profile, 10x baseline. Failures block the tag. Results land in the Ironoak dashboard; check p99 latency and error rate. Tags must be signed or the pipeline refuses them. The release signing key is below.

rollout seal: bky4_x7Gc

Ticket: Missed pick-up — signed contracts, Harbrook office

Hey team, the courier from Quillstone Transit never showed yesterday for the signed Merrivale contracts, so they're still sitting in the Harbrook mailroom safe. Legal needs them at the Dunsley office before Thursday's countersigning session, so we've rebooked for tomorrow morning's window. Reception at your end should expect a padded grey folio, sealed and stamped. Please make sure whoever accepts it follows the hand-over instruction below exactly.

handover note for yagef-bagep: the drudor pelius courier leaves the kasdor zorvan norir ledger at gate 8016 under passcode 755406